Phase 1: International INJO Program atthe Stanford University
2006-2009 - 12 leading Pakistani journalists toparticipate in the Innovation JournalismFellowship Program at Stanford University.
Each Fellow to refine expertise in reporting oninnovation and become a part of the INJOcommunity.
The Program also targets in: Bridging technology and business
reporting in Pakistan; Linking the Pakistani reporters with
newsrooms in the US and other countries. Create better understanding on how
innovation is reported More content on innovation in Pakistan

Phase 1: TCI Annual Conferences
Participation of 18 leading journalists at theCompetitiveness Institute’s Annual Conferences2006 -2009
Interaction with journalists and cluster practitioners –Innovation Journalism for inter-cluster communication
Brainstorming on leading issues concerninginnovation and competitiveness
Putting media at the center of the triple helix

Phase 2: Building a Network of INJOsCurrently working with 465 journalists across Pakistan Interactive workshops and training sessions for working
journalists in collaboration with WEF and INJO Program –12 Pillars of the Global Competitiveness Index and theNetwork Readiness Index of the World Economic Forum
INJO Fellows are mentors and provide guidance on theconcepts of Innovation Journalism
Subsequently participant increase public focus onInnovation through news, articles and media reports onInnovation
Wish-list: Collaboration with other INJO initiatives Create a Journalist of the Year Award on Innovation Journalism

Phase 3: New Resource Development
Interaction of INJO Fellows with the business andjournalism schools
Working closely with the Higher Education Commission ofPakistan (HEC) to provide guidelines to improve andincorporate the Innovation Journalism concepts in thenational curriculum for mass communication andjournalism
Joint workshops with media, academia and the HECPresentations to the Standing Committees of the
Parliament on Finance, Education, Science andTechnology, IT & Telecom, Information and Media on theimportance of Innovation Journalism for sustainedeconomic growth
